Transaction 3aefb881595df5a362a6876b199778dcba0e95ed1503d5d0832d7a2262febd43
1 Input
1 Output
-
3aefb881595df5a362a6876b199778dcba0e95ed1503d5d0832d7a2262febd43:0
- value
- 6081
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5b9643ddec5aeaa31c7fa9be498e6d368d5ac0215acba232a68d97d5a291b994
- address
- bc1ptwty8h0vtt42x8rl4xlynrndx6x44spptt96yv4x3ktatg53hx2qrqtps5